IP查询
查询
你查询的IP:[118.224.127.184] 地理位置:中国–北京–北京
最新查询
203.95.17.175
119.176.166.145
121.60.65.39
118.244.232.218
124.20.31.212
218.240.225.56
220.234.69.139
121.16.11.213
58.144.4.65
118.224.127.184
202.20.120.114
221.199.192.14
117.121.192.172
203.100.80.142
116.13.16.163
202.149.224.104
123.112.238.239
222.160.211.50
125.32.67.15
121.59.105.6
202.127.16.132
121.52.160.102
121.32.31.216
58.192.47.243
60.194.63.255
202.127.212.163
203.142.219.195
218.240.85.123
119.63.32.84
210.12.58.174
59.107.96.24